HERNDON - A three-vehicle accident sent a truck and trailer hauling a small log cabin through guardrail and down an embankment Saturday on Route 147 about two miles south of here.
The crash, about one mile north of the Route 225 intersection, closed the highway between Mandata and Herndon for several hours.
The left front of the white truck hauling the cabin was lodged into the ground as the vehicle straddled tiny Fiddler's Run about 10 feet off the east berm of the highway. The trailer - the log cabin still intact on top of it - was hanging over the 5-foot embankment but still partially on the highway.
A short distance north, a Dodge Ram pickup truck sat against the guardrail on the same side of the highway, its rear axle and wheels torn from its driver's side. Further north, the third vehicle, an SUV that suffered heavy rear-end damage, sat against guardrail on the other side of the highway.
One person reportedly suffered minor injuries and, after initially refusing treatment, was convinced he should visit the hospital.
State police at Stonington responded, but had not provided any further details about the crash as of Saturday night.
